Seeking RAs for New Study of an Attachment-Based Program @ University of Maryland

We are currently seeking up to two fulltime research assistants. A parttime position is also possible. These positions will be for a minimum of 1.5 years as part of an NICHD-funded R01 study. The main RA responsibilities will consist of recruiting mothers at a pediatric clinic and conducting home-based data collection with mothers and their infants via maternal interview and videorecorded research activities.

The ideal candidates will be bilingual/bicultural individuals with prior experience in research/program evaluation and substantive interest/expertise in attachment and/or infant mental health.

These positions will offer great opportunities to individuals looking to gain hands-on experience before applying to a graduate program.

All project staff will be part of a dynamic community-based intervention research team committed to promoting equity and to careful mentoring of junior team members.
